萤火商城2.1.1UniApp前端

萤火商城 v2.1.1 的 uniapp 端源码还挺适合用来啃一波实战的。代码结构清晰,功能也比较完整,像商品列表、订单流程、用户中心这些电商标配的模块全都有。你只要会点 Vue,基本就能顺着逻辑跑起来。

uniapp 的多端兼容能力挺强,写一套代码,H5、小程序、App 都能跑。对于想练手毕业设计或者搞副业的开发者来说,这种一次开发多端复用的项目真的省心不少。

项目里前端的页面交互还不错,常用的组件像uni-listuni-popup都用得挺顺手。你要是想自定义点效果,改样式也挺方便,比如加个position: fixed的悬浮购物车,改个按钮风格啥的,容易上手。

后端虽然没包含在压缩包里,但配合 API 文档,自己接个 Node 或 PHP 也不难。接口设计上是标准的RESTful风格,比如/api/goods/list,直接分页返回数据,前后端分离得挺清楚。

数据库结构参考意义也蛮大,像userorderproduct这些表设计比较规范,字段命名清晰,用 SQL 语句练习查询效率优化也有。

安全这块也别忽视,像用户密码就得加密存储,用bcrypt加盐是基础。防 XSS 可以用v-html时配合过滤,接口加个权限校验中间件,整体安全性就提升不少。

如果你手上有 CI/CD 的习惯,用GitHub Actions或者GitLab CI连着 uniCloud 部署一下,就能实现自动打包发版,开发效率还能再上一档。

萤火商城 v2.1.1这套源码比较适合拿来做学习案例,也适合二开用在自己的项目里。如果你正好在学uniapp,或者打算做个电商类应用,真挺值得下载看看。

zip 文件大小:995.97KB